A while ago there was some software or a method you could do to change altitude on the autopilot very quickly and easily without having to left mouse click and hold until you blow past your desired altitude. I somewhat remember hitting ~320 for FL320. There must of been other commands for heading and speed. I am on a notebrick so I don't have the scroll wheel.

Hello Cockpit Commander is the one you want.It allows you to enter ALT,HEAD,COURSE,SPEED ETC +ATC commands too.Feels odd at first but once you get the feel of it you can execute your commands very quickly.No more frantic wheel mouse spinning.This is by Glen Copeland (as Dave mentioned)cheers Andy
